Output 0660177878b924336a2fe374e67a793847206d0fade2668159872b0d41bb7aae:3

value
113243
script pubkey
OP_0 OP_PUSHBYTES_20 5b95dc5a5db15a316a187c44ef0d2c87568c749f
address
bc1qtw2ackjak9drz6sc03zw7rfvsatgcaylhpfvfa
transaction
0660177878b924336a2fe374e67a793847206d0fade2668159872b0d41bb7aae
confirmations
180074
spent
true